NCM-MCI Exam at a Glance

Before diving into the strategic importance of topic weight, let's establish a clear picture of what the Nutanix Certified Master - Multicloud Infrastructure exam entails. Understanding these fundamental details is the first step in effective planning.

Key Exam Details for NCM-MCI

  • Exam Name: Nutanix Certified Master - Multicloud Infrastructure
  • Exam Code: NCM-MCI
  • Exam Price: $300 USD
  • Duration: 180 minutes
  • Number of Questions: 16-20 (Performance-based scenarios)
  • Passing Score: 3000 on a scale of 1000-6000
  • Product Version: v6.10

The NCM-MCI exam is not a typical multiple-choice test; it comprises performance-based questions that require candidates to execute tasks within a simulated Nutanix environment. This format demands practical, real-world experience, making theoretical knowledge alone insufficient for success. 1. Monitoring & Troubleshooting

This domain is arguably one of the most critical for a Master-level professional. In real-world multicloud environments, issues are inevitable, and the ability to rapidly identify, diagnose, and resolve them is paramount. Performance-based exams often test these skills rigorously.

Key Focus Areas:

  • Advanced Health Monitoring: Understanding Prism Central dashboards, alerts, metrics, and leveraging external monitoring tools.
  • Performance Analysis and Tuning: Identifying bottlenecks (CPU, memory, storage, network), analyzing performance trends, and implementing corrective actions.
  • Log Analysis: Proficiently navigating and interpreting various Nutanix logs (hypervisor, CVM, service logs) to pinpoint root causes.
  • Network Troubleshooting: Diagnosing connectivity issues, understanding flow visualization, and resolving network-related performance problems in a multicloud context.
  • Storage & Data Path Troubleshooting: Identifying I/O anomalies, understanding storage policies, and troubleshooting data integrity issues.
  • High Availability & Disaster Recovery Validation: Verifying replication, failover mechanisms, and recovery point/time objectives (RPO/RTO).

Inferred Weight: High. Expect multiple, complex scenarios that demand a systematic approach to problem-solving. This area often ties into other domains like Optimize & Scale and Security, making it foundational. Strong skills here demonstrate true operational mastery.

3. Security

Security is non-negotiable in any IT environment, especially in multicloud deployments. The NCM-MCI expects candidates to implement robust security postures, protecting data and infrastructure from threats across different cloud platforms.

Key Focus Areas:

  • Identity and Access Management (IAM): Advanced configuration of authentication (LDAP, SAML, Keystone) and authorization (RBAC) across Nutanix and connected cloud services.
  • Network Security: Implementing Flow Network Security policies, microsegmentation, VPNs, and firewall rules within the Nutanix environment and external cloud.
  • Data Encryption: Understanding and configuring data-at-rest encryption (SEDs, software encryption) and data-in-transit encryption.
  • Security Hardening: Applying best practices for hardening Nutanix components (AOS, hypervisor, Prism Central) and integrated services.
  • Auditing and Compliance: Configuring audit logging, security event monitoring, and understanding compliance frameworks relevant to multicloud.
  • Data Protection & Integrity: Ensuring data integrity and preventing unauthorized access or modification.

Inferred Weight: Medium to High. Given the critical nature of security, it's a significant domain. Expect scenarios involving policy enforcement, access control configuration, and ensuring compliance across a multicloud landscape. It's an area where attention to detail is paramount.

5. Business Continuity

Ensuring continuous operation and rapid recovery from disruptive events is a cornerstone of enterprise IT. This domain focuses on designing and implementing robust business continuity and disaster recovery (BC/DR) solutions with Nutanix.

Key Focus Areas:

  • Disaster Recovery Planning: Designing comprehensive DR strategies using Nutanix technologies like Leap (DRaaS), Metro Availability, and Protection Domains.
  • Recovery Point Objective (RPO) & Recovery Time Objective (RTO) Configuration: Implementing solutions to meet specific RPO and RTO requirements.
  • Backup and Restore Operations: Configuring data protection policies, leveraging Nutanix Mine or integrated backup solutions, and performing restores.
  • DR Testing and Validation: Designing and executing DR drills, failover, and failback procedures in a multicloud context.
  • Data Replication Strategies: Understanding synchronous and asynchronous replication, and their appropriate use cases.
  • Cloud Bursting & Spilling: Implementing strategies for extending capacity to public clouds during peak demands or for disaster recovery.

Inferred Weight: Medium to High. For a Master certification, BC/DR is a critical operational and design aspect. Expect scenarios that test your ability to configure, manage, and troubleshoot replication and recovery mechanisms. Practical experience with failover and failback is crucial here.

1. What is the target audience for the Nutanix Certified Master - Multicloud Infrastructure (NCM-MCI) certification?

The NCM-MCI is designed for experienced IT professionals, system administrators, and architects who are responsible for designing, implementing, managing, and troubleshooting complex Nutanix enterprise cloud environments, particularly those extending into multicloud scenarios. Candidates should have extensive hands-on experience with Nutanix products.

2. How long is the NCM-MCI certification valid, and what are the `Nutanix NCM-MCI certification requirements` for renewal?

The NCM-MCI certification is valid for two years. To maintain your certification, you typically need to retake the current version of the NCM-MCI exam before your certification expires or pass a higher-level exam if one becomes available. Always check the official Nutanix certification page for the most up-to-date renewal policies.
